Signatures: A-N⁴.
Edition statement precedes author's name on the title page
Running title reads: The tragedy of Hamlet Prince of Denmarke
Bartlett, H.C. Shakespeare early editions
Bartlett & Pollard. Shakespeare's quartos (rev. ed.)
Boston Public Library. Barton collection catalogue
ESTC
STC (2nd ed.)
Boston Public Library (Rare Books Department) copy bound by Clarke & Bedford in red morocco-grained leather paneled in double-ruled gilt with rolled edges and gilt turn-ins. Spine paneled and tooled in gilt. All text block edges gilt. Armorial bookplate of the Barton Library. Paper repairs at head of title page, with corner or edge repairs to leaves A2, B1, B2, C1, and F4.
